Newman Confluence

Abstract

Terminating locally confluent rewrite systems have globally joinable reductions.

Theorem 1.1 (Every pair of reductions is joinable).

Proof. Machine-checked in Lean as D5/S0/Rewriting/NewmanConfluence.newman_confluent (✓ std3). ∎

Citation. M. H. A. Newman (1942). On Theories with a Combinatorial Definition of “Equivalence”. DOI: 10.2307/1968867.

Commentary.

For every terminating and locally confluent rewrite relation, any two reflexive-transitive reductions from a common source reach a common successor.
